About this Movie
Movie Description
A bounty hunter on the trail of three escaped convicts makes a startling discovery deep in the Rockies. He finds evidence of a Native American tribe thought to have been decimated a century ago, and with the help of an anthropologist he races to save the last of the Dog Soldiers from the ravages of the modern world.

Synopsis
Bounty hunter Lewis Gates is assigned to retrieve three criminals from the mountains of Montana. But when he discovers that the trio has mysteriously disappeared from the area, Gates does some research, and is surprised to find that 17 others have vanished from the same locale. So Gates, with the help of anthropologist Lillian Sloan, attempts to unravel the mystery, which leads to the discovery an unknown -- and undiscovered -- tribe of Cheyenne Indians.

Film Notes
Shot on location in Mexico and Canada.

Color by DeLuxe; shot in Panavision widescreen.

Thespian canine Zip (an Australian cattle dog) plays himself.

Rated BBFC PG by the British Board of Film Classification.
